htdemucs 4-source weights, ggml format

HT-Demucs (Demucs v4) weights converted to the ggml binary format used by demucs.cpp, for running music source separation in WebAssembly.

Stems, in output order: drums, bass, other, vocals. Weights are f16.

Verification

Loaded into a demucs.cpp WebAssembly build and run against a real 44.1 kHz stereo recording: the model initialises in 0.2 s and the four stems reconstruct the input at 28.5 dB SNR.
